Vintage Airline Seat Map: American Airlines Boeing 727-100 from 1977
I’m sticking with a narrowbody again for this week’s Vintage Airline Seat Map and bring you the American Airlines Boeing 727-100 from 1977 appearing below. Seating a total of 100 passengers, this pre-deregulation configuration offered 14 first class seats and room for 86 in coach, which probably had nearly equivalent seat pitch as that found…

American Airlines announces fleet-wide Main Cabin Extra seating
American Airlines today announced they will be overhauling their entire mainline fleet to include extra legroom seating in economy, effectively matching United’s Economy Plus and Delta’s Economy Comfort offering. The new ‘Main Cabin Extra’ seats will feature four to six inches of additional legroom and include early boarding privileges. AAdvantage Executive Platinum, Platinum and full-fare…
